Case Studies of Diverse Games
Several games exemplify successful diversity in design. Titles like “The Last of Us Part II” feature complex characters from various backgrounds. This approach resonates with a broader audience. Engaging narratives can drive sales. Additionally, “Overwatch” showcases diverse heroes, appealing to different player demographics. Representation matters in gaming.
